Output 109432ae830f42804bbdaf7961f60d4b2a2abca7c79799aa5de670c0f0bb1c82:0

value
75490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beadca477feeca8e3cdf791ce6717ac45a41b53 OP_EQUAL
address
3JpdduVb2HG5PuczDnLYnyQW237dPbXVcr
transaction
109432ae830f42804bbdaf7961f60d4b2a2abca7c79799aa5de670c0f0bb1c82
spent
true